Liquor worth rs 3 lakh seized from secret tank beneath false toilet seat

The Ahmedabad Rural Local Crime Branch (LCB) on Sunday seized 792 bottles and tins of Indian-made foreign liquor (IMFL) worth ₹2.76 lakh from a house in Chunaravas, Bareja village, where the accused had allegedly built a storage tank hidden beneath a false Indian toilet seat.

Acting on specific and credible information, a team raided the premises. The operation was carried out as part of a district-wide crackdown on illegal liquor and gambling dens, initiated under the directives of Inspector General Vidhi Chaudhary and Ahmedabad Rural Superintendent of Police Om Prakash Jat.

During the search, police discovered that the accused had devised an elaborate concealment method—constructing a secret underground tank within the house and disguising its entrance with a false Indian-style toilet seat to evade detection. The hidden compartment contained both large and small bottles of IMFL along with beer tins, which were subsequently seized.

An FIR has been registered, and police said further investigation is underway to determine the supply chain and identify other individuals involved in the illicit liquor trade in the district.
